如何实现高级搭建五河app软件?

作者:信阳麻将开发公司 阅读:1 次 发布时间:2026-03-24 11:21:16

摘要:提到高级搭建五河app软件,这个过程是在做一个类似于微信、QQ、支付宝这类大型应用的开发工作,也是非常具有挑战性的。本文从五个大方面系统性地介绍了如何实现高级搭建五河app软件,包括:先期准备工作、基础功能开发、高级功能开发、性能优化和安全加固。希望对您进行项目实施有所帮助。1. 先期准备工...

  提到高级搭建五河app软件,这个过程是在做一个类似于微信、QQ、支付宝这类大型应用的开发工作,也是非常具有挑战性的。本文从五个大方面系统性地介绍了如何实现高级搭建五河app软件,包括:先期准备工作、基础功能开发、高级功能开发、性能优化和安全加固。希望对您进行项目实施有所帮助。

如何实现高级搭建五河app软件?

  1. 先期准备工作

  在实施开发工作之前,我们需要进行充分准备,确保项目能够高效进行。先期准备工作包括如下几个方面:

  1.1 需求确认与规划

  项目开发之前需要对需求进行充分确认与规划,明确项目需求、开发方向,这是保证项目成功的第一步。

  1.2 成本与时间预估

  开发项目需要耗费大量的时间和成本,需要对项目的开发周期和预算进行充分评估和规划,预估成本与时间对项目实施成功至关重要。

  1.3 团队组建

  高级搭建五河app软件需要有一个强大的团队来完成项目开发,组建团队需要考虑成员的技能和专业性,以此搭配原则进行人员招聘。

  2. 基础功能开发

  除了先期准备工作,还需要做好基础功能开发,包括用户注册、登录、个人资料设置等操作。这里我们以用户注册为例进行说明,包括以下步骤:

  2.1 页面设计

  注册页面的设计需要考虑标签的更换、输入框的长度、以及注册按钮的位置,通过设计降低用户操作的难度。

  2.2 功能实现

  实现注册功能需要后端的支持,后端需要实现对注册数据的保存和密码的加密,同时还需要进行格式验证和错误提示的功能设计。

  2.3 前后端交互

  注册功能的实现需要前后端交互来确认按钮是否可用、保存数据格式是否正确、保存是否成功等问题。

  3. 高级功能开发

  在基础功能实现的基础上,还需要开发复杂的高级功能,例如语音聊天、视频通话、支付、地图定位等等。这里我们以地图定位为例进行说明,主要分为以下几个步骤:

  3.1 地图API接入

  要实现地图定位功能,需要接入地图API,如百度地图、高德地图,调用他们提供的接口来获取自己的位置信息和各种周围的信息。

  3.2 技术方案设计

  技术方案主要包括定位算法的选择、精度精准度的确定、以及地图UI设计的问题,都是一个非常重要的工作。

  3.3 功能实现

  通过提供的接口获取到用户的位置信息,再将这些信息保存到数据库中,再通过提供的查询接口来辅助处理查询请求。

  4. 性能优化

  性能是一个项目提高质量和提升用户体验的关键因素,前期的性能设计和后期的性能优化都是不可忽视的工作。需要采取以下措施来优化性能:

  4.1 代码压缩

  代码压缩可以减少HTTP请求次数和网络传输的效果,同时也可以在响应前对JavaScript文件进行处理,加快页面加载时间。

  4.2 静态资源CDN

  采用CDN来管理静态资源可以优化并行传输,如图片、CSS、JavaScript等文件,可以有效加快页面响应时间并支持流媒体。

  4.3 后台缓存

  对于高并发访问的网站应该采用后台缓存的技术来提升网站性能,提高访问速度,提升用户体验。

  5. 安全加固

  最后一个要点是在进行开发过程中要考虑软件安全问题。常见的安全问题有:防火墙、数据加密、数据备份等等。下面我们以数据加密为例进行说明:

  5.1 SSL 加密

  采用 SSL 加密技术,可以防止数据在传输过程中被黑客攻击、拦截等过程,提高数据安全性。

  5.2 数据存储加密

  数据加密是保证数据安全的重要手段之一,对于敏感的数据应该采用加密技术进行加密,保证信息的安全性。

  5.3 安全管理系统

  对于敏感数据应该建立一套完善的安全管理系统,如:访问控制、日志审计、风险预警等,这样才能保证数据的安全。

  本文主要介绍如何实现高级搭建五河app软件。无论是哪个开发项目,都需要先期准备工作,开发基础功能和高级功能、性能优化、安全加固等环节,才能实现高效高质量的项目。在开发过程中,还需要不断尝试新的技术和方案来提高软件的质量和用户体验。

  随着移动互联网的快速发展,APP软件已经成为了人们生活不可或缺的一部分。如今,各种类型的APP层出不穷,其中五河app软件的开发也逐渐成为了人们关注的焦点。但是,如何实现高级搭建五河app软件呢?本文将从技术选型、UI设计、功能开发、测试发布、运营推广等方面详细介绍,希望对想要开发高质量五河app软件的开发者有所启发。

  1. 技术选型

  技术选型是五河app软件开发中最重要的环节之一。首先,需要明确自己的开发需求,包括所需技术栈、平台适配、版本更新、数据存储等。其次,需要根据所需功能选择适合的开发框架和工具,如React Native、Flutter等。最后,需要对整个技术栈进行评估与1.调优、保证软件的整体质量。

  2. UI设计

  UI设计是五河app软件用户体验的重要组成部分。设计师需要设计出符合用户习惯的界面,提高用户的使用体验,并在设计过程中注意细节、提高美观性。设计过程中需要合理分配和选择配色方案,明确图标的设计风格,统一字体规范等。重要的是,在设计完成后进行用户测试,从而给出自己的意见和改进意见。

  3. 功能开发

  五河app软件的功能开发是关键所在,开发人员应该明确用户的需求,务必避免“脱离事实”的功能开发,以便更好地为用户服务。在开发过程中,应该采用模块化、组件化等开发方式,提高代码的复原性,加快功能开发速度。同时,保证代码质量和可读性,增强软件的可维护性,提高用户体验。

  4. 测试发布

  五河app软件开发完成后,需要进行测试发布。首先,需要对软件进行测试,包括功能测试、兼容测试、性能测试等,避免一些常见的bug。然后,将应用发布到相应的应用商店中,以在大范围内推广应用。此外,在重要版本更新时,开发者应该主动发布更新,维持用户的使用体验,增加新功能和修复bug。

  5. 运营推广

  运营和推广是五河app软件的最后一个关键环节。市场运营包括软件渠道的运营、营销策略的推广、用户反馈的处理、数据分析等。开发者应该根据不同的营销策略,包括直接营销、KOL 营销、社交营销等,以便更好地推广应用,增加用户数量并增强用户黏度。同时,积极收集用户反馈,提高软件质量、增加用户体验。

  总之,这是一个复杂的问题,但是只要在技术选型、UI设计、功能开发、测试发布和运营推广这五个方面多做功夫,开发者就能够轻松创建出优秀的五河app软件。希望本文能够对大家有所启发,对APP开发者提供参考和帮助。

  • 原标题:如何实现高级搭建五河app软件?

  • 本文由信阳麻将开发公司网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与物智科技网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员

    点击这里给我发消息电话客服专员

    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 24小时客服热线电话 🔺🔺

    免费通话
    返回顶部